Jemma Barnard, one of the state’s most promising young legal minds, was today named Rising Star for Injury & Compensation Law in the Queensland rankings of the industry trusted Doyle’s Guide 2024.

In an exciting double triumph, Ms Barnard is also set to be appointed Partner at Travis Schultz & Partners (TSP), rising from Senior Associate to become the newest member of the firm’s leadership team.

Inclusion in Doyle’s annual rankings is one of the most sought-after accolades across all sectors of the legal profession, determined through peer-review surveys, as well as extensive telephone and face-to-face interviews with clients, peers, and industry bodies.

She adds that importantly, mindset is key for lawyers wanting to advance.

“Find your people – those who share your values, are passionate about professional development, and love what they do – and, say yes to opportunities, especially those out of your comfort zone – from discomfort, comes true growth,” she said.

The Queensland and Australian Doyle’s Guide is an annual listing of the best lawyers based on peer surveys with rankings determined on ability and the quality of positive feedback. More information about the 2024 Doyle’s Guide rankings can be viewed at www.doylesguide.com
